What Causes Wet Carpet After Water Damage Restoration?
Several factors can contribute to wet carpets after restoration efforts. Common causes include:
- Inadequate Drying: If the drying equipment was not powerful enough or not left in place long enough, moisture can linger.
- Improper Water Extraction: Insufficient water extraction during the initial cleanup can lead to leftover moisture.
- Humidity Levels: High humidity in Boynton Beach can slow down the drying process, making it difficult for carpets to dry completely.
- Underlay Issues: If the carpet underlay remains wet, it can keep the carpet damp even after surface drying.

How Long Should My Carpet Take to Dry After Water Damage Restoration?
Typically, carpets should dry within 24 to 48 hours after restoration. However, several factors can affect this timeframe:
- Type of Carpet: Thicker carpets may take longer to dry than thinner ones.
- Environmental Conditions: High humidity or low temperatures can extend drying times.
- Drying Methods: Effective methods like dehumidification and air circulation can significantly reduce drying time.

What Can I Do If My Carpet Is Still Wet After Restoration?
If your carpet remains wet, here are steps you can take:
- Increase Airflow: Use fans or open windows to promote airflow around the carpet.
- Utilize Dehumidifiers: A dehumidifier can help remove moisture from the air, speeding up the drying process.
- Check for Underlay Moisture: If the underlay is wet, consider professional extraction services to address it.
- Inspect for Mold: If the carpet remains wet for too long, it may develop mold, requiring immediate remediation.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
Homeowners often make several mistakes that can exacerbate wet carpet issues:
- Neglecting to Monitor Humidity: Ignoring humidity levels can prolong drying times.
- Using Inadequate Equipment: Not using industrial-grade drying equipment can lead to insufficient drying.
- Postponing Action: Waiting too long to address wet carpets can lead to mold growth and structural damage.
By avoiding these mistakes, you can improve your chances of successfully drying your carpet after water damage restoration.
